Being an experienced English speaker does not guarantee you a high score

It can come as a surprise to test takers, who consider themselves to be fluent in English, that they can score less well in an English test than they expect.

Dr. Alistair Van Moere, a member of Pearson’s Technical Advisory Group, explains that it’s not unusual for people who have recently learned English to score higher than those that have spoken English for a long time. This happens on all high-stakes tests, not just on PTE Academic, as fluent speakers are often not prepared to do the test. PTE Academic contains question types that a fluent English speaker may not have done for a long time, for example, writing an essay.

This is why all test takers, including fluent English speakers, should prepare before test day.

    Working Holiday/Work and Holiday visas (subclass 417 & subclass 462) 

    Are you looking for a visa that provides an incredible opportunity for self-discovery, growth and learning? Travel to Australia and you'll meet new people, learn about a variety of cultures and develop new skills and interests. 

    The Working Holiday and Work & Holiday visas allow people from 18 to 30 years old (or 35 years old for some countries) to have an extended holiday in Australia and work to help fund their trip (not accompanied by dependent children). 

    As part of your visa application, you will need to provide proof of your English language skills. PTE Academic is accepted by the Australian Government Department of Home Affairs for all visa categories, including Working Holiday Maker program visa applications. 

    The cost of applying for either the Working Holiday visa or the Work and Holiday visa is AUD 650. If you choose to extend your visa (for up to a second or third year), you must pay another AUD 650 each time. Note: Extensions are available if you meet specific work requirements in regional Australia.
